All About 'Magnetizing': Meaning, Strategy & Finding Words From Letters
Meaning:
The term magnetizing refers to the process of making something magnetic or attracting it with a magnetic force. This word is commonly found in standard Scrabble dictionaries, acknowledging its legitimacy for word game enthusiasts.
About the Word:
In various contexts, magnetizing can be used both literally, as in the process of magnetizing a material, and figuratively, to describe the act of captivating someone's interest or attention. The letters of this word can be transformed into multiple smaller words, highlighting its versatility in word games and the excitement of discovering words from letters.
Etymology:
The word magnetizing is derived from the root word "magnet," which has its origins in the Greek word magnēs, meaning "Magnesian stone," a naturally occurring magnetic mineral. The suffix “-izing” indicates the action of making or becoming, further emphasizing its dynamic nature.
